Output 6681234c6858e2e96e40a0429676fe8b69441a94e3efe3330757ee755b7e3c04:1

value
20264357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e9f46c78fb0e210b8ad157b119edf8262c75af2 OP_EQUAL
address
3G9jVaRDe8BHLwthxaV7EAX9aavGpY3NCk
transaction
6681234c6858e2e96e40a0429676fe8b69441a94e3efe3330757ee755b7e3c04
spent
true